PRE-SALE
covers of Chitty on Contracts, 36th Edition, Volumes 1 and 2

Chitty on Contracts, 36th Edition, Volumes 1 and 2

Chitty on Contracts, 36th Edition, Volumes 1 and 2

PRE-SALE
covers of Chitty on Contracts, 36th Edition, Volumes 1 and 2